The property market has an enormous effect on our environment. Building houses, transporting materials, and developing on land can all dramatically increase carbon emissions. As there has been a heightened awareness about the matter, it is really obvious that green building will remain a leading trend over the next few years. The effect of sustainability in real estate industry is more significant than just development and construction. In many locations throughout the world, powerful ramifications of changing climate like flooding or heat waves can affect house prices. It is crucial to keep in mind that sustainable real estate topics can exist in numerous different ways. Restoring historic buildings in local neighborhoods, as an example, reuses existing materials like reclaimed wood and stone.
